PANEL & SYSTEM DESCRIPTION

PRODUCT NAME:
GlazeGuard® 1000
Opaque Glazing Panels

OVERVIEW:
GlazeGuard® 1000 is a composite panel made by laminating either textured or smooth aluminum skins (or porcelain enamel steel) to tempered hardboard substrates. These stabilizers surround a core of expanded polystyrene or polyisocyanurate foam. Panels are furnished with a strippable film (or interleafed microfoam) on the painted surfaces to protect the finish during shipment and installation. GlazeGuard® 1000 is installed in aluminum glazing/storefront channels (typically on setting blocks) and sealed using gaskets. No mechanical fasteners or adhesives are used in the installation of the panel.

BASIC USES & APPLICATIONS:
As an alternative or complement to glass, GlazeGuard® panels provide an excellent choice for use as glazing infill, spandrel panels, modesty screens, and railing inserts. These panels are typically used on various types of buildings including schools and universities, retail complexes, storefront conditions etc... However, with an impact resistant composition and a foam core GlazeGuard® 1000 panels are ideal for any other application where increased thermal properties, durability and safety are concerns.

GENERAL LIMITATIONS:
GlazeGuard® panels are designed to be installed in glazing channels or other similar type channels where all four edges are sealed. The panels are not eligible for use as a wall cladding or system. No moldings are available with GlazeGuard® panels.

SYSTEM FINISHES:
GlazeGuard® 1000 panels are available with either smooth or textured prefinished aluminum or porcelain enamel steel skins. Standard colors in textured skins are offered with a coil coated polyester. Premium colors are also available with an acrylic urethane coating. Smooth standard and metallic colors are furnished with a durable Kynar 500® coating. Anodized finishes are also standard. Whether smooth or textured, both finishes can be ordered in custom colors to match customers’ standard. Porcelain enamel steel is available in both standard and premium colors.

FEATURES & BENEFITS:
As a line of glazing infill solutions, GlazeGuard® offers a number of benefits to the building owner, architect, and installer including:
  • Versatile
    With a complete line of options, GlazeGuard® panels offer solutions for water and fire resistant compositions in addition to the standard panel.
  • Durable
    Whether installed in new or retrofit applications, the tempered hard- board stabilizers provide superior impact and dent resistance.
  • Low Maintenance
    Little or no maintenance is required and most grease, dirt, oil, and other foreign material can be easily cleaned from the surface.
  • Increased Thermal Value
    When compared to glass, GlazeGuard® offers an attractive alternative with increased R-values gained from panels 1” to 3-1/2” thick.
  • Variety Of Finish Options
    GlazeGuard® panels are available in a wide range of colors and finishes. From solid tones in textured aluminum and porcelain enamel steel to metallic and anodized finishes in smooth skins, these panels provide the designer with a broad palette to work from.
